git: Use PCRE (#2350)
[termux-packages] / packages / php / ext-standard-dns.c.patch
CommitLineData
e054b9eb
FF
1diff -u -r ../php-5.6.15/ext/standard/dns.c ./ext/standard/dns.c
2--- ../php-5.6.15/ext/standard/dns.c 2015-10-29 05:55:01.000000000 -0400
3+++ ./ext/standard/dns.c 2015-11-10 16:05:47.473119979 -0500
4@@ -938,7 +938,7 @@
5
6 /* Skip QD entries, they're only used by dn_expand later on */
7 while (qd-- > 0) {
8- n = dn_skipname(cp, end);
9+ n = __dn_skipname(cp, end);
10 if (n < 0) {
11 php_error_docref(NULL TSRMLS_CC, E_WARNING, "Unable to parse DNS data received");
12 zval_dtor(return_value);
13@@ -1049,14 +1049,14 @@
14 cp = (u_char *)&ans + HFIXEDSZ;
15 end = (u_char *)&ans +i;
16 for (qdc = ntohs((unsigned short)hp->qdcount); qdc--; cp += i + QFIXEDSZ) {
17- if ((i = dn_skipname(cp, end)) < 0 ) {
18+ if ((i = __dn_skipname(cp, end)) < 0 ) {
19 php_dns_free_handle(handle);
20 RETURN_FALSE;
21 }
22 }
23 count = ntohs((unsigned short)hp->ancount);
24 while (--count >= 0 && cp < end) {
25- if ((i = dn_skipname(cp, end)) < 0 ) {
26+ if ((i = __dn_skipname(cp, end)) < 0 ) {
27 php_dns_free_handle(handle);
28 RETURN_FALSE;
29 }